Mumbai (BOM) to Mogilev (MVQ)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Chhatrapati Shivaji International Airport (BOM) in Mumbai, India to Mogilev Airport (MVQ) in Mogilev, Belarus is 5,307 kilometers (3,298 miles / 2,866 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 7h, flying north northwest at a heading of 327°.

This is a long-haul route typically operated by wide-body aircraft such as the Boeing 777 or Airbus A350. Full meal service, in-flight entertainment, and comfort amenities are standard.

This is an international route connecting India with Belarus. It is an intercontinental flight between Asia and Europe.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 17:39 in Mumbai, it's 15:09 in Mogilev.

The return flight from Mogilev (MVQ) to Mumbai (BOM) follows a heading of 120° (east southeast).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
